Common use of Tenant's Notice of Default Clause in Contracts

Tenant's Notice of Default. Tenant agrees, provided the mortgagee, ground landlord or trust deed holder under any mortgage, ground lease, deed of trust or other security instrument ("Mortgagee") shall have notified Tenant in writing (by the way of a notice of assignment of lease or otherwise) of its address, Tenant shall give such Mortgagee, simultaneously with delivery of notice to Landlord, by registered or certified mail, a copy of any such notice of default served upon Landlord. Tenant further agrees that said Mortgagee shall have the right to cure any alleged default during the same period that Landlord has to cure such default.
